About the University of Maryland

The University of Maryland is the state’s flagship university and one of the nation's preeminent public research universities. A global leader in research, entrepreneurship and innovation, Maryland is ranked No. 21 among public universities by U.S. News & World Report. The Institute of Higher Education, which ranks the world’s top universities based on research, puts Maryland at No. 38 in the world and No. 29 among U.S. universities. Our faculty includes three Nobel laureates, two Pulitzer Prize winners, 49 members of the national academies and scores of Fulbright scholars.
